A person is declared to be dead upon the irreversible cessation of spontaneous body functions; brain activity, or blood circulation and respiration. However, only about 1% of a person's cells have to die in order for all of these things to happen. Explain how a person can be dead when 99% of his/her cells are still alive, and provide examples with your explanation.
